Transaction 50b84afa5103e345d446d9b41653ba7124314e618649815068c698b183f35d93
1 Input
1 Output
-
50b84afa5103e345d446d9b41653ba7124314e618649815068c698b183f35d93:0
- value
- 275458
- script pubkey
- OP_0 OP_PUSHBYTES_20 f32d8586e402c72ae5e80b3bacb60f3e9c34c94c
- address
- bc1q7vkctphyqtrj4e0gpva6eds086wrfj2vs47qpy